Rabbi Dunner draws on a beautiful essay from the Rav Daniel Alter Haggadah to find the deeper meaning of freedom on Pesach. Moving beyond the physical Exodus, he explores a powerful message about the lingering mindset of slavery, challenging us to shed internal limitations and embrace a renewed sense of identity, dignity, and spiritual independence long after leaving Egypt.
